The suffix "-itis" means "inflammation" in English, so appendicitis is inflammation of your appendix. The process of combining word roots or a suffix and prefix with a combining vowel is known as the combining form. The suffix(-otomy) refers to cutting or making an incision, while (-ostomy) refers to a surgical creation of an opening in an organ for the removal of waste.
